The Thrill of Speedrunning
Imagine playing your favorite game, but with a twist – you have to finish it as fast as possible. That’s the essence of speedrunning. Gamers meticulously plan their routes, execute flawless maneuvers, and exploit glitches to shave off precious seconds from their time. The thrill of breaking records and achieving the impossible is what drives speedrunners to keep pushing themselves to the limit.
Community and Camaraderie
Despite the competitive nature of speedrunning, the community is incredibly supportive and tight-knit. Online forums, social media groups, and live streaming platforms provide a space for speedrunners to share strategies, celebrate achievements, and commiserate over setbacks. The sense of camaraderie among speedrunners is palpable, with veterans mentoring newcomers and everyone cheering each other on during marathon events.
Challenges of Speedrunning
While speedrunning may seem like a thrilling and rewarding endeavor, it comes with its fair share of challenges. One of the biggest obstacles for speedrunners is the immense amount of practice and dedication required to master a game. Hours of repetition, precise timing, and mental fortitude are essential to achieving top-tier speeds. Additionally, dealing with the frustration of failed runs, unexpected glitches, and RNG (random number generator) can test even the most patient of gamers.
Technical Limitations
Another challenge that speedrunners face is the ever-evolving nature of games and hardware. Patches, updates, and new console generations can render old speedrunning strategies obsolete, forcing speedrunners to adapt and innovate constantly. The need to stay up-to-date with the latest techniques and trends in the speedrunning community is a perpetual challenge that keeps speedrunners on their toes.
Mental and Physical Strain
Speedrunning is not just a test of gaming skill but also a test of mental and physical endurance. Long hours of intense focus, repetitive motions, and high-pressure situations can take a toll on a speedrunner’s well-being. It’s crucial for speedrunners to maintain a healthy balance between gaming and self-care to prevent burnout and fatigue.
